Getting It Done! How to Complete Your Dissertation – Methods and Motivation

11.09.2024 - 12.09.2024 09:00-17:00

Addressees:
Doctoral candidates in the final year of their PhD

Goals:
The “Getting it Done”-workshop provides you with the tools you need to tackle the final stage of your dissertation with as little hassle as possible: We discuss tried and tested methods which you will use to draw up a realistic project schedule. It is also important for you to keep working continuously until you finally submit the dissertation. To that end, you will learn how to develop strategies which will help you to cope with persistent levels of stress and strain. Depending on the specific needs and interests of the participants we will also focus on techniques for efficient writing, the topic of supervision and support, and questions concerning the defense.

Content Outline:
• Project scheduling: How to draw up a realistic project schedule for the final stage of your dissertation
• Iterative incremental planning
• Basic strategies and tools for an efficient Time- and Self-Management (i.e. Pomodoro Technique, Phases of Productivity, Implementation intentions …)
• Setting Priorities
• Efficient Writing
• Pragmatism and Productivity
